Charlotte Gayle (Williams) Smith, 65, of El Dorado, Arkansas, ran joyfully home to the Lord on Tuesday, March 24, 2026, in Rogers, Arkansas, after a long and courageous battle with cancer, surrounded by her large and loving family.
She was born on October 26, 1960, in El Dorado, Arkansas, the youngest child of Olen “Pete” Williams and Mildred Walker Williams. She spent most of her life in El Dorado before moving to Prairie Grove four years ago to be closer to her grandchildren and to receive medical care.
Charlotte was a loving wife, mother, grandmother, sister, and friend who loved deeply and unconditionally. She had a generous heart and could not bear to see anyone in need without offering help. She was known for opening her home not only to family and friends, but also to anyone—human or animal—who needed care, comfort, or belonging.
She found great joy in arts and crafts, a passion she carried from her school days, where art was her favorite subject. It was during those years that her lifelong love story began, as her middle-school sweetheart would visit her classroom window with flowers from his mother’s florist shop. That young man became her devoted husband, Kenneth W. Smith, and together they built a life of love that would have reached 49 years of marriage this coming May.
Charlotte was her children’s loudest cheerleader and created a home filled with warmth, laughter, and welcome. Their friends were always treated like family and wanted to gather there. She loved hosting, and holidays in her home were full of joy, beauty, and celebration.
She had a gift for laughter and a quick wit, making wisecracks and bringing joy to those around her all the way to her final days. She loved the Lord and faithfully reflected His light to all who knew her.
